Inspired by a treasure discovered along the shoreline, Gem of the Sea is a beautifully detailed pendant designed to capture the magic of a found sea treasure. Created with light bronze base metal clay, this piece has a rich, warm golden tone—giving you the look of gold without the hefty price tag.
You’ll create your own little treasure with a dimensional pocket designed to cradle a sparkling CZ. Learn how to precisely set a fireable CZ directly into the metal clay so it becomes a permanent part of your finished piece.
Don’t let the intricate details fool you—this project is suitable for all skill levels, from beginners to advanced metal clay artists. You’ll be guided step-by-step through the construction and setting techniques, making this a fun project whether you’re just getting started or looking to add another technique to your metal clay toolbox.
Base metal clay requires an extended firing process. Because of this, your finished pendant will be available for pickup the following day or can be mailed to you at no additional cost.
Material Kit Includes: Light bronze base metal clay, fireable CZ, use of shared tools, consumables, and printed instructions. All tools will be provided for students to use during class. Kit fee $35
